#67E062 Hex Color Code

#67E062

The Hexadecimal Color #67E062 is a contrast shade of Light Green. #67E062 RGB value is rgb(103, 224, 98). RGB Color Model of #67E062 consists of 40% red, 87% green and 38% blue. HSL color Mode of #67E062 has 118°(degrees) Hue, 67% Saturation and 63% Lightness. #67E062 color has an wavelength of 545.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#67E062 is #99FF66.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#67E062 is #6D6. The Closest Color to #67E062 is #90EE90. Official Name of #67E062 Hex Code is Screamin' Green.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#67E062 is 54 Cyan 0 Magenta 56 Yellow 12 Black and #67E062 CMY is 54, 0, 56.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#67E062 is hsl(118,67,63,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(118, 56, 88).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#67E062 is 34.45, 57.07, 20.75.
Hex8 Value of #67E062 is #67E062FF. Decimal Value of #67E062 is 6807650 and Octal Value of #67E062 is 31760142. Binary Value of #67E062 is 1100111, 11100000, 1100010 and Android of #67E062 is 4284997730 / 0xff67e062.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#67E062 is 0.307, 0.508, 0.508 and YIQ Color Space of #67E062 is 173.457, -31.6201, -64.8027.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#67E062 is 46.39, 72.76, 21.29.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#67E062 is 80.22, -58.24, 50.8.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#67E062 is 80.22, -55.48, 73.78.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#67E062 is 80.22, 77.28, 138.9. Hunter Lab variable of #67E062 is 75.54, -50.8, 36.6.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#67E062

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
